What does Jemmima mean and where does it come from?
Jemmima is a variant of Jemima, which is derived from the Hebrew name יְמִימָה (Yemimah), meaning 'dove'.
Cultural significance
The name Jemima appears in the Bible as one of Job's daughters, symbolizing beauty and grace.
